Signs You Need Septic Line & Baffle Repair
Call sooner rather than later when Jamesville properties show these Septic Line & Baffle Repair symptoms.
- Slow drains despite cleaning
- Sewage backing up into the home
- Gurgling drains throughout the house
- Wet spots or odors near the septic tank

Failed baffles cause sewer backups and field saturation. Inlet and outlet pipes require targeted repair or replacement. Septic baffles prevent solids from entering drain fields.
